• Home
  • Raw
  • Download

Lines Matching refs:temp64

220 	u64 temp64 = (u64)parent_rate;  in clk_pllv3_av_recalc_rate()  local
222 temp64 *= mfn; in clk_pllv3_av_recalc_rate()
223 do_div(temp64, mfd); in clk_pllv3_av_recalc_rate()
225 return parent_rate * div + (unsigned long)temp64; in clk_pllv3_av_recalc_rate()
237 u64 temp64; in clk_pllv3_av_round_rate() local
248 temp64 = (u64) (rate - div * parent_rate); in clk_pllv3_av_round_rate()
249 temp64 *= mfd; in clk_pllv3_av_round_rate()
250 do_div(temp64, parent_rate); in clk_pllv3_av_round_rate()
251 mfn = temp64; in clk_pllv3_av_round_rate()
253 temp64 = (u64)parent_rate; in clk_pllv3_av_round_rate()
254 temp64 *= mfn; in clk_pllv3_av_round_rate()
255 do_div(temp64, mfd); in clk_pllv3_av_round_rate()
257 return parent_rate * div + (unsigned long)temp64; in clk_pllv3_av_round_rate()
269 u64 temp64; in clk_pllv3_av_set_rate() local
278 temp64 = (u64) (rate - div * parent_rate); in clk_pllv3_av_set_rate()
279 temp64 *= mfd; in clk_pllv3_av_set_rate()
280 do_div(temp64, parent_rate); in clk_pllv3_av_set_rate()
281 mfn = temp64; in clk_pllv3_av_set_rate()
311 u64 temp64; in clk_pllv3_vf610_mf_to_rate() local
313 temp64 = parent_rate; in clk_pllv3_vf610_mf_to_rate()
314 temp64 *= mf.mfn; in clk_pllv3_vf610_mf_to_rate()
315 do_div(temp64, mf.mfd); in clk_pllv3_vf610_mf_to_rate()
317 return (parent_rate * mf.mfi) + temp64; in clk_pllv3_vf610_mf_to_rate()
324 u64 temp64; in clk_pllv3_vf610_rate_to_mf() local
335 temp64 = rate - parent_rate * mf.mfi; in clk_pllv3_vf610_rate_to_mf()
336 temp64 *= mf.mfd; in clk_pllv3_vf610_rate_to_mf()
337 do_div(temp64, parent_rate); in clk_pllv3_vf610_rate_to_mf()
338 mf.mfn = temp64; in clk_pllv3_vf610_rate_to_mf()